gecko-dev/gfx/tests/reftest
Jamie Nicol b4da4c2fb4 Bug 1823411 - Give all webrender's shader varyings an explicit precision. r=gfx-reviewers,lsalzman
Mali profiling tools have shown we are frequently fragment bound, in
particular due to varying interpolation. To help mitigate this, we
should use mediump where possible. Currently most of our varyings are
implicitly highp by default. This patch reduces their precision to
mediump where possible. When varyings must remain highp for
correctness reasons, this is now stated explicitly.

As expected, this does cause a fair bit of reftest fuzziness on
Android devices. This patch also updates reftest expectations to
reflect this.

Differential Revision: https://phabricator.services.mozilla.com/D173028
2023-03-21 19:05:19 +00:00
..
468496-1-ref.html
468496-1.html
611498-1.html
611498-ref.html
709477-1-ref.html
709477-1.html
853889-1-ref.html
853889-1.html
1086723-ref.html
1086723.html
1131264-1.svg
1143303-1.svg
1149923-ref.html
1149923.html
1419528-ref.html
1419528.html
1424673-ref.html
1424673.html
1429411-ref.html
1429411.html
1435143-ref.html
1435143.html
1444904-ref.html
1444904.html
1451168-ref.html
1451168.html
1461313-ref.html
1461313.html
1463802-ref.html
1463802.html
1474722-ref.html
1474722.html
1501195-ref.html
1501195.html
1519754-ref.html
1519754.html
1523080-ref.html
1523080.html
1523776-ref.html
1523776.html
1524261-ref.html
1524261.html
1524353-ref.html
1524353.html
1616444-same-color-different-paths-ref.html
1616444-same-color-different-paths.html
1662062-1-no-blurry.html
1662062-1-ref.html
1681610-ref.html
1681610.html
1687157-1-ref.html
1687157-1.html
1696439-1-ref.html
1696439-1.html
1722689-1-ref.html
1722689-1.html
1724901-1-helper.svg
1724901-1-ref.html
1724901-1.html
1724901-2-helper.html Bug 1739015. Add another, better, reftest for bug 1724901. r=hiro 2021-11-03 00:41:36 +00:00
1724901-2-ref.html Bug 1739015. Add another, better, reftest for bug 1724901. r=hiro 2021-11-03 00:41:36 +00:00
1724901-2.html Bug 1739015. Add another, better, reftest for bug 1724901. r=hiro 2021-11-03 00:41:36 +00:00
1761460-ref.html Bug 1761460 - Fix local space clip rects on snapped surfaces with reflections r=gfx-reviewers,nical 2022-03-30 08:42:56 +00:00
1761460.html Bug 1761460 - Fix local space clip rects on snapped surfaces with reflections r=gfx-reviewers,nical 2022-03-30 08:42:56 +00:00
1761685-1-ref.html Bug 1761685 - Check for negative step in blendTextureNearestRepeat. r=gfx-reviewers,jrmuizel 2022-03-28 01:47:58 +00:00
1761685-1.html Bug 1761685 - Check for negative step in blendTextureNearestRepeat. r=gfx-reviewers,jrmuizel 2022-03-28 01:47:58 +00:00
1765862-ref.html Bug 1765862 - Skip backdrop-filter if nsIFrame reports not visible for painting r=gfx-reviewers,lsalzman 2022-05-06 01:12:05 +00:00
1765862.html Bug 1765862 - Skip backdrop-filter if nsIFrame reports not visible for painting r=gfx-reviewers,lsalzman 2022-05-06 01:12:05 +00:00
1792527-1-ref.html Bug 1792527 - Explicitly bind mip filter for external textures inside WebRender. r=gw 2022-10-10 19:23:51 +00:00
1792527-1.html Bug 1792527 - Explicitly bind mip filter for external textures inside WebRender. r=gw 2022-10-10 19:23:51 +00:00
1801588-1-ref.html Bug 1801588 - Ensure region outside mask but inside clip is cleared for copy op. r=aosmond 2022-11-28 17:54:29 +00:00
1801588-1.html Bug 1801588 - Ensure region outside mask but inside clip is cleared for copy op. r=aosmond 2022-11-28 17:54:29 +00:00
1806140-notref.html Bug 1806140 - Handle the italic face of the macOS system font. r=gfx-reviewers,jrmuizel 2022-12-17 20:10:54 +00:00
1806140.html Bug 1806140 - Handle the italic face of the macOS system font. r=gfx-reviewers,jrmuizel 2022-12-17 20:10:54 +00:00
1812341-ref.html Bug 1812341 - Fix 3d transforms bug with backface-visibility: hidden r=gfx-reviewers,jrmuizel 2023-01-29 23:38:27 +00:00
1812341.html Bug 1812341 - Fix 3d transforms bug with backface-visibility: hidden r=gfx-reviewers,jrmuizel 2023-01-29 23:38:27 +00:00
1972885-ref.html Bug 1792285 - Part 2: Do proper subpixel snapping before pushing iframe to WebRender. r=gfx-reviewers,gw 2022-11-01 20:32:07 +00:00
1972885.html Bug 1792285 - Part 2: Do proper subpixel snapping before pushing iframe to WebRender. r=gfx-reviewers,gw 2022-11-01 20:32:07 +00:00
Ahem.ttf
blacktrans.png
bug1523410-translate-scale-snap-ref.html
bug1523410-translate-scale-snap.html
bwinton.jpg
dino.png Bug 1761685 - Check for negative step in blendTextureNearestRepeat. r=gfx-reviewers,jrmuizel 2022-03-28 01:47:58 +00:00
pass.svg
picture-caching-on-async-zoom.html
reftest.list Bug 1823411 - Give all webrender's shader varyings an explicit precision. r=gfx-reviewers,lsalzman 2023-03-21 19:05:19 +00:00